| Pakistan troops battle for Swat - 23 May 09 | |
| At least ten people have been killed in a bomb blast in the Pakistani city of Peshawar. The attacker struck a cinema during the evening, when the area was packed with people. Peshawar is the gateway to Pakistan's northwest tribal belt -where the army is fighting the Taliban. Al Jazeera Englishs Mike Hanna sent this special report from inside the conflict zone. | |

| Speed Reading the Global Warming Bill | |
| Republicans attempt to block passage of the Global Warming Bill by requiring that it be read aloud in session in its entirety. Democrats respond by hiring a speed reader. | |
